Transaction 87e017777ef575bf160ca70fc203672532ea13ed921b06a91823c4763ecbacdd

1 Input
2 Outputs
  • 87e017777ef575bf160ca70fc203672532ea13ed921b06a91823c4763ecbacdd:0
  • value  10544
    address  33tTTY859f4Fjfo2cbDd226vX8L6kBR8HN
  • 87e017777ef575bf160ca70fc203672532ea13ed921b06a91823c4763ecbacdd:1
  • value  1017872
    address  1FtxmRsWNGMqUkPvXcn3ifVVgWM1pQUjzw